The 1990 film Europa Europa is based on the autobiography I Was Hitler Youth Saloman and relates the true story of Solomon Perel, a Jewish boy who escaped the savagery of the Holocaust by masquerading as an ethnic German. Angela Merkel, the first female Chancellor of Germany, has served in that position...Berlin: Symphony of a Metropolis (1927) Berlin: Symphony of a Metropolis is a silent documentary film directed by Walter Ruttmann. It was released in 1927 and is considered one of the pioneering works of the city symphony genre in filmmaking. ( 1978-10-30) Summer of My German Soldier is a 1978 American television film based on the 1973 novel of the same name written by Bette Greene. The Third Reich era of Germany ("Nazi Germany") lasted from Adolf Hitler 's assumption of power on 30 January 1933 to Karl Dönitz 's surrender at the end of World War II on 8 May 1945.
